Real analysis
Edward James McShane, Truman Arthur Botts
This text surveys practical elements of real function theory, general topology, and functional analysis. Discusses the maximality principle, the notion of convergence, and the Lebesgue-Stieltjes integral is introduced in terms of the ideas of Daniell, measure-theoretic considerations playing only a secondary part. Explores function spaces and harmonic analysis as well. Includes exercises. 1959 edition.
